Cairo, Egypt, June 15, 2011- The African Volleyball Confederation (CAVB) will organize the first ever Data Volley Course in the framework of the CAVB Strategic Plan 9 to 11 July 2011 in Cairo, the capital of Egypt.
The 4 days course aims at increasing the coaching ability according to the new technology all over the world. Two delegates will be invited by CAVB from each of the 53 African National Federations who have a sufficient knowledge about the rules of the game as well as the coaching experience.
In order to achieve the maximum benefit from the course the CAVB will provide each National federation a Laptop, Data Volley Program (software) and Data Volley -Video Program (software).
